Carrigoona Commons East Hill Carraig Úna Thoir A name in Irish Source, Logainm.ie. Wicklow County in Leinster Province, in Binnion List, Quartzite Bedrock

Height: 242m OS 1:50k Mapsheet: 56 Grid Reference: O23383 15235
Place visited by 109 members. Recently by: glencree, marktrengove, TommyMc, nupat, NualaB, Tommer504, hibby, Kaszmirek78, hak493r, michaelseaver, marcellawalking, Dee68, megk971, Ansarlodge, newpark-cc
I have visited this place: NO (You need to be a logged-in member to change this.)

Longitude: -6.15574, Latitude: 53.173259 , Easting: 323383, Northing: 215235 Prominence: 103m,  Isolation: 2.2km
ITM: 723294 715231,   GPS IDs, 6 char: CrgnCm, 10 char: CrgnCmnsEs
Bedrock type: Quartzite, (Bray Head Formation)

Was known as 'Winny's Rock or Winifreds Rock. According to Logainm Carrigoona Commons West is at O23018 15036, which would be nearly on the road to the SW.   Carrigoona Commons East is the 1300th highest place in Ireland.

Easy ascent for interesting views.
Short Summary created by simon3, mcrtchly  9 Nov 2014
This summit is a northerly extension of the Great Sugar Loaf, though separated from this by a road. It has some great views. One place to start is around O23156 15611 starA where there is parking for 2 or 3 cars. Walk up a boggy tractor track to the summit. There is an easy scramble near the top. Up and down in 25 minutes. Alternatively take a minor road on the left whilst driving up the Rocky Valley Drive from Kilmacanogue and park near to water storage tanks besides a house at O23422 15355 starB. Less than 10 minutes walk along path to the summit.
There have been a number of gorse fires over the years on Carrigoona Commons and the nearby Great Sugar Loaf, threatening houses. Linkback: https://mountainviews.ie/summit/1223/comment/15467/

Ordinary hill with sugar coated views
by Colin Murphy  25 Jul 2019
Started from just outside the farm as suggested in short summary, where a friendly farmer warned me of recent car break-ins and not to leave anything visible. The walk was simplicity itself - 10 minutes to the top and met several people walking dogs on the way - it's clearly a popular spot with locals. The top itself is a large, dome-shaped rock offering fine panoramas. If nothing else, this top can claim to be the best spot in Wicklow to view Great Sugar Loaf, whose rocky face which rises steeply from the landscape just 1km to the south.
